Spidermans Apprentice
   Rex Tyler, 02.05.2007 · Printable version
 


Spidermans apprentice that is Jamie
He wears the tea-shirt
with a lot of pride
He isn't scared of spiders
those, 8 legged
creatures
He's little
but he takes them
in his stride

His Daddy doesn't like them
But he saw some
great big hairy spiders
in the zoo
Jamie's the apprentice
to young spider man
and wishes he could fly
on silk webs too

Jamie likes to eat
corn tricolore
he comes and buys
it at the Cooks Delight
he likes to suck that sour
sweet that ends up sweet
and always looks and acts
so very bright

His mother is
a kindly caring person
she always has
a happy word to say
Spiders often get harsh
treament so I've heard
But Jamie seems to
love them more each day
